iPhone stops showing contact names and won’t dial contacts

There is an issue that happens with iOS from time to time and has for many versions where contact names disappear from the Phone app and you only see the phone numbers. Further, when clicking on a contact a call fails to be placed generally with an error message from the Carrier. You may also notice that your data continues to work and that if you manually type a phone number you can call it. You may also notice that whenever you call from clicking on a contact that you see something about “Dial Assist” on the main screen.

There are two fixes you can try in order to alleviate this, neither of which require a reset. They should be tried in this order.

Fix 1

  1. Start the Contacts app
  2. Click on the “Groups” link which is likely in the top left corner
  3. Ungroup or remove the check marks from all of the selected entries then click “Done”
  4. Click “Groups” again and reselect the previous entries then click “Done”
  5. Restart your phone

This approach worked for me to restore all functionality.

Fix 2

This won’t fix the core issue but will allow you to click on a contact and call that number. You can disable dial assist and it will then correct call the contact number if it is properly formatted.

  1. Click Settings
  2. Click Phone
  3. Turn off Dial Assist

Although Fix 2 will restore some functionality, Fix 1 is what we’re really hoping works because it will fix the problem AND dial assist will continue working. This was verfied on iOS 12.1.4 where these instructions were created from however the issue has existed for some time over a wide span of iOS versions.